Output d5657f242659b87ffa0827f7861076110c1b002a3cc0bc26a7d4635745d7de94:1

value
30786000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22bd4c1128ef25734eeabea269d623642e51aaaa OP_EQUAL
address
9ubxQWPtt8SDduREhmy4yMhF7jmpXkQCvg
transaction
d5657f242659b87ffa0827f7861076110c1b002a3cc0bc26a7d4635745d7de94